overconnectivity (uncountable)

  1. Excessive connectivity
    • 2015 August 27, “Semi-Metric Topology of the Human Connectome: Sensitivity and Specificity to Autism and Major Depressive Disorder”, in PLOS ONE[1], →DOI:
      Such heterogeneity of results has been attempted to be reconciled by suggesting that ASC is characterised by overconnectivity in brain systems associated with the phenotype, whilst underconnectivity is presented in those systems that are neurotypical, both probably as a result of aberrant developmental processes [44 ].
